Before opening my virtual practice, I spent years working with children and teens navigating anxiety, big emotions, behavioral challenges, trauma, and major life transitions. Those experiences taught me how to stay grounded when a child is overwhelmed, how to connect even when words are hard to find, and how to help families shift from frustration to connection. Today, I pair that clinical foundation with specialized training in EMDR, child development, emotional regulation, and telehealth tools like Hopscotch Play, Teleo, and Minecraft Education—so therapy feels engaging, safe, and genuinely helpful.
